Eng sync note — Brackwater user-module split, phase 2.

Defaults changed this week. New `userd` service now owns session validation; monolith falls back only on timeout. Default timeout dropped from 5s to 1200ms. Shadow-write mode is off by default now; enable explicitly for backfill jobs. Read traffic splits 80/20 toward `userd`, up from 50/50. Rollback path unchanged. No schema changes this cycle. Teams consuming the legacy user endpoints should migrate before the freeze. Current default configuration for `userd` follows.

service settings:
PRAIX_LOG_LEVEL=error
PRAIX_METRICS_HOST=metrics.praix.qorvelcorp.corp
PRAIX_POOL_SIZE=16

Handover — fire drill, Wexhall Depot. Drill is Thursday 10:00. Contractors muster at Point C, far car park. Bring the contractor roll-call clipboard from the gatehouse; tick names against the day's sign-in sheet. Report totals to the warden in the orange tabard. Late arrivals wait at the gate. Gatehouse door opens with the code below.

door code, yagap-bahof: bdg-O-05

## Changelog — AgriLink Gateway v2.8.0

Changed defaults: the Harrowfield telemetry gateway now ships with TLS 1.3 enforced for all uplink connections, and the anonymous diagnostics endpoint is disabled out of the box. Retry backoff was raised from 5 to 30 seconds to reduce burst traffic from field units after outages. These changes affect fresh installs only; upgraded units retain prior settings. For audit purposes, the full set of shipped defaults is reproduced below.

config for faduf-fahip:
ELIAX_LOG_LEVEL=error
ELIAX_METRICS_HOST=metrics.eliax.zemvarcorp.corp
ELIAX_POOL_SIZE=16

Minutes — Management Meeting, Branch Operations

Attendees: regional leads; chaired by Ines Farrow. The committee reviewed the decision to reduce the marketing budget by fifteen percent across all Drellbury branches. Discussion covered campaign prioritization, protection of the Solmark launch, and reallocation toward retention activity. Branch managers will submit revised spend plans within ten days. The confidential rationale is recorded below.

internal memo for yahag-hahig: Belwynix Group plans to lower the Silir list price by 62 percent in May.